Tall Walker With Seat - Rollators For Tall Person

A tall walker and seat or rollator for tall people is a device for mobility that aids users in walking more comfortably. It also includes seating for resting.

drive-blue-4-wheel-walker-folding-rollator-with-padded-seat-locking-brakes-height-adjustable-handles-and-carry-bag-437.jpgWhen choosing a rollator lightweight walkers for seniors, ensure the handle's height is suitable for your height. To determine the correct hand grip height, stand in your regular shoes and place your arms on your sides with an incline at the elbow.

Seat-to-floor height

In contrast to normal walkers tall rollators are specifically designed to be used by people who are 6 feet or taller. They have a seat that allows users to sit on and can be used indoors or out. They can be adjusted to meet the height of the person using them. It is essential to test the device and take measurements prior to deciding on a taller model. The height of the handle for instance, needs to be adjusted so that the user can hold it comfortably without bending.

A tall rollator can be lifesaver for those suffering from backaches or other conditions that make standing for prolonged periods of time difficult. A rollator that has an integrated seat can offer support to the upper part of the body and allow the user to relax.

Many older adults who are taller have difficulty reaching their standard handles on walker's that are made for people who are who are 5'3" or 5'11" tall. This can result in the user stooping and causing neck or shoulder pain. A taller rollator addresses this problem with easy-to use height-adjustable handle for people over 6'2".

When testing a new rollator have the user stand straight, wearing their normal shoes, and hold the grips. They should be able to keep the grips of their wrists while keeping their arms slightly bent at an angle of 20-30 degrees. The height of the handle can be adjusted to the proper height to ensure that the user is able to comfortably hold the walker without bending down uncomfortable.

Handle height

If you're tall it can be difficult to find a rolling device that is the perfect fit. A good rollator for tall people will have a height-adjustable handle that lets you position the grips so that they are comfortable for your hands. This will help reduce the strain and fatigue on your back, neck and shoulders. This rollator type can also improve your posture when walking. People who are taller and utilize walkers frequently sit up when using their mobility aids, which could cause back pain. However, a taller rollator with an adjustable handle can eliminate this issue by allowing you to keep your head elevated while using the device.

A reliable rollator is essential for taller people because of its capacity to hold weight. Be sure that the device can support your weight without over-loading since over-loading can result in injuries or even break the device. It's recommended to test drive a new rollator prior to purchasing it to ensure it is suitable for your needs and is comfortable to use. You can do this by sitting on the seat and then grabbing the handles.

To determine the ideal handle height for your walker, put on regular shoes with your arms in front of you and your elbows bent slightly. Then, take a measurement from the ground to the center of your wrist to determine the ideal size for your walker. Certain models also have an adjustable grip on the hand for an even more customized experience, which can be helpful if you're using it for extended periods of time.

Seat height

The seat height on rollators for tall people must be sufficient to ensure that the user can rest comfortably. The handle's height must be sufficient to allow the user to comfortably hold the rollator with their hands in a comfortable posture, with a slight bend of the elbow. Hand grips should be at wrist level. It is advisable to ask someone else to help you determine this height. You can do this by standing in normal shoes and asking someone in your family or a friend to take a measurement of the distance between your palm and elbow while holding a walker or commode.

Stores

A tall person who uses a best rollator has many storage options. They include trays and baskets that allow users to carry personal items without leaving the walker. This reduces the chance of injuries from falls and other accidents caused by leaving a walker for a long period of time to get items. Some walkers also have a seat that can be used as a place to rest on when a user gets exhausted from walking.
